INTRODUCTION (A SWOP ANALYSIS)

• Strength: School teachers have been teaching science and mathematics and presumably possess high level PCK

• Weakness: • school science and mathematics are taught in isolation

• School organize curriculum and man power also in silos

• Teachers face challenges in acquiring technological and engineering knowledge (Chai, 2019)

INTRODUCTION

• Opportunity: • Technological advancements such as the emergence of 3D printing, micro- computers

and block-based coding environments have contributed to the expansion of Maker movement (Resnick & Rosenbaum, 2013)

• Many useable teaching videos available for various types of technology• STEM are closely interrelated content areas. One way to understand the

interrelationships is in the context of solving real world problems. Engineering is the discipline that applies scientific knowledge and mathematical computation to design processes or products (i.e. technologies) to address the problems (Brophy, Klein, Portsmore & Rogers, 2008). Technologies in turn, are used to facilitate scientific and mathematical knowledge advancement and engineering design.

• Engineering or making problems afford authentic and active learning for science and mathematics

THEORETICAL FRAMEWORK: TPACK-STEM

• Dedicated effort in teacher PD to promote teachers’ STEM teaching competencies is lacking (Al Salami, Makela, & de Miranda, 2017; Cavlazoglu & Stuessy, 2017; for a review, see Chai, 2019)

• Pedagogical content knowledge (PCK) (Shulman, 1986) has been proposed as the quintessential teacher’s professional knowledge

• However, to develop strong PCK in one area is already challenging

• To develop interdisciplinary STEM knowledge is very challenging

2007, TPCK changed to Thompson, A., & Mishra, P. (Winter 2007-2008). Breaking News: TPCK becomes TPACK! Journal of Computing in Teacher Education, 24(2).TPACK The basic understanding is that ICT integration involves the synthesis of three basic forms of knowledge: content knowledge, pedagogical knowledge and technological knowledge. Any lesson that miss any one of the component can not be considered as ICT integrated. The art and science of ICT-based teaching lies in the efficiency, effectiveness and elegance (3E?) of the design

SCAFFOLDED TPACK LESSON DESIGN MODEL (STLDM)

Identify Instructional Goals

Analyze learners & context

Identify learning objectives

Subject Goals Consideration (CK)What are the educationally and developmentally sound attitudes, skills (higher-order thinking and process), and knowledge that students should learn for the subject matter?TK TCK/TPCKCan the topic be represented by technologies such that it becomes pedagogically more powerful?

Pedagogical Content Consideration (PCK)What are learners’ difficulties in learning the topic? What are the usual misconceptions? What are the strengths and weaknesses for the existing ways of teaching the topic? PCKTPCKCould the existing PCK be enhanced with technology?

Design DecisionArticulate learners’ appropriate objectives and arrange the list of objectives starting from the cognitively most challenging (i.e. Higher order thinking) objectives

Stage 1

Page 11: DRAWING ON TECHNOLOGICAL PEDAGOGICAL CONTENT KNOWLEDGE (TPACK…fmipa.unj.ac.id/smic2020/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/SMIC... · 2020. 8. 9. · THEORETICAL FRAMEWORK: TPACK -STEM •

Plan Instructional and Learning Activities

Choose relevant technologies / Develop

ICT-based resource

Develop assessment: Formative & Summative

PKWhat are the specific 21st century learning practices (reflective learning, collaborative learning, authentic problem solving, active and constructive learning etc.) that can be integrated? What are the possible problems and necessary supports for students to engage in the learning practices?

TPKWhat are some good practices associated with the chosen technologies? Any consideration for cyberwellnessissue?Any good ICT tools for assessing emerging understanding? TCKHow do subject matter experts use technology to represent and make meaning of the topic?TPACK-resourcesAre there existing good quality online resources already created ?

Stage 2 Design Decision• Selection of student-centric teaching

and learning activities supported by technologies

• Determination of means to assess students’ learning processes and learning outcomes

• Craft evaluation rubrics for the digital artifacts created by students

Scaffolded TPACK Lesson Design Model (STLDM)

REFLECT, IMPLEMENT AND REVISE

• Does the pedagogical design make sense after the complete draft is out? How does it qualify as contributing to meaningful learning?

• Are the various activities logically connected and building on each other?

• Any implementation challenges?

• Implementation, reflection in action

• Revise based on reflection in action and other thoughts

REAL WORLD (AUTHENTIC)

• [What is this? What are the properties/characteristics?]• Properties: ill-defined, open-ended, demand information

• [Why proposed this?] • Potential: engender acquisition, participation, creation (problem solving)• Promote learning motivation, retention, transfer, 21CC (critical, creative)• Problem addressed: irrelevance, simplification, de-contextualization, inert knowledge

• [How do we as teachers do this?]• Pedagogical move: create context (event, place, people), scaffold, roles• ICT: presenting problems, use of authentic ICT tools (TCK) for the practice (e.g. use of

office tools for office workers; use CAD for engineering; excel for modeling etc)

Page 14: DRAWING ON TECHNOLOGICAL PEDAGOGICAL CONTENT KNOWLEDGE (TPACK…fmipa.unj.ac.id/smic2020/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/SMIC... · 2020. 8. 9. · THEORETICAL FRAMEWORK: TPACK -STEM •

LEARNING BY DOING (ACTIVE/ HANDS-ON)• Properties: active, interactive, participative, experiential

• Potential: facilitate acquisition, demand participation, lead to creation (problem solving) [why]

• Promote learning motivation, retention, transfer, 21CC (critical, creative, collaborative)

• Problem addressed: passive absorption, inert knowledge

• Pedagogical move: design activities, define performance (SIOs), sequence activities (hierarchical), create instruction

• ICT: Providing authentic tools, interacting with computers and through computers (read, talk, search, evaluate, synthesize, construct, manipulate, revise, etc)

Page 15: DRAWING ON TECHNOLOGICAL PEDAGOGICAL CONTENT KNOWLEDGE (TPACK…fmipa.unj.ac.id/smic2020/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/SMIC... · 2020. 8. 9. · THEORETICAL FRAMEWORK: TPACK -STEM •

COLLABORATIVE LEARNING• Properties: interactive, participative, negotiation

• Potential: facilitate acquisition, demand participation, create shared meanings [why]

• Promote socio-emotional well-being, thinking (ZPD), 21CC (critical, creative, communicative, collaborative)

• Problem addressed: individualistic, competitive,

• Pedagogical move: identify topics for discussion (relevance, prior knowledge, interest, cognitive value) , foster interaction rules, monitor talks, mediate conflicts, facilitate reflections

• ICT: Interacting around computers and through computers, platforms for collaborative co-construction of cognitive artifacts/ideas

Page 16: DRAWING ON TECHNOLOGICAL PEDAGOGICAL CONTENT KNOWLEDGE (TPACK…fmipa.unj.ac.id/smic2020/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/SMIC... · 2020. 8. 9. · THEORETICAL FRAMEWORK: TPACK -STEM •

CONSTRUCTIVE (MINDS-ON)

• Properties: • Prior knowledge, beliefs, experience & mis-understanding affect the formation of new knowledge

• Active sense making is required to understand

• Potential: Build meaningful schema

• Promote effective and efficient learning, retention, creative thinking

• Problem addressed: fragmented understanding, inert knowledge

• Pedagogical move: assess prior knowledge , provide opportunities to activate prior knowledge(questioning, video, Quiz etc)

• ICT: Use of content free tools to construct digital files to represent one’s idea (for e.g.: constructing a concept map; a ppt)

Page 17: DRAWING ON TECHNOLOGICAL PEDAGOGICAL CONTENT KNOWLEDGE (TPACK…fmipa.unj.ac.id/smic2020/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/SMIC... · 2020. 8. 9. · THEORETICAL FRAMEWORK: TPACK -STEM •

SELF-DIRECTED LEARNING (INTENTIONAL)• Properties: self-initiated, intentional, self-plan and manage

• Potential: Promote learn how to learn, life-long learning, metacognition

• Traits of all strong learners and high performers

• Problem addressed: passive learning, unmindful rote leraning

• Pedagogical move: identify what, where and when can students make learning decision, facilitate goal setting, strategies selection, monitoring, self-regulation, reflection

• ICT: Learning Blog,

DISCUSSION

• The design of STEMQuest that we have designed, mediated by the learning website was seen as a meaningful design task that helps the preservice teachers to negotiate the integration of multidisciplinary knowledge into interdisciplinary STEM project with acceptable representation of individual subject

• It facilitates the teachers to use their respective TPACK and their technological content knowledge (TCK) to contribute to the interdisciplinary STEM project

• The teachers gain knowledge and skills to work with other disciplines grow in epistemic fluency

Page 38: DRAWING ON TECHNOLOGICAL PEDAGOGICAL CONTENT KNOWLEDGE (TPACK…fmipa.unj.ac.id/smic2020/wp-content/uploads/2020/08/SMIC... · 2020. 8. 9. · THEORETICAL FRAMEWORK: TPACK -STEM •

EPISTEMIC FLUENCY (MARKAUSKAITE& GOODYEAR, 2017)

• Is about being a productive member in multidisciplinary knowledge work that creates innovative solutions to complex real world problem

• It requires different ways of knowing and using different knowledge resources and working with different professionals

• Cultivating epistemic fluency is a key aims for today educators

• But How to build people in multidisciplinary context in learning, knowing, relating and acting which are intertwined?
